HSE University Comes Second in SuperJob Graduate Salary Ranking

SuperJob has published its annual ranking of Russian universities by salary earned by young professionals working in finance and economics. The ranking was based on data on university graduates for the period 2017–2022.

First, second, and third place in the ranking went to MGIMO University, HSE University, and Lomonosov Moscow State University respectively.

Sergey Pekarski

Graduates of the HSE University Faculty of Economic Sciences are in-demand in the labour market for several reasons, notes Dean of the faculty Sergey Pekarski. ‘Firstly, HSE University attracts the strongest applicants: those with the highest USE scores and winners of olympiads. As such, there is the effect of the initial selection of the most talented and driven students,’ he explains. ‘The second factor is the high global standards of education. Students gain not only applied skills which are often more quickly and effectively mastered at work, but also undergo fundamental training in economic theory, finance, and modern instrumental methods of working with data. Thirdly, student economists learn through a project-based learning model that provides an opportunity to conduct research into real tasks under the guidance of employers and to build an individual learning trajectory.’

The HSE University Faculty of Economic Sciences places great emphasis on the formation of soft skills (identifying problems, suggesting solutions, presentations, arguments, discussions, etc), highlights Sergey Pekarski. All of this helps graduates to adapt flexibly to the rapidly changing realities of the market economy and government policy, and to continue developing throughout their lives, he concludes.

The ranking compiled by the SuperJob research centre is based on a comparison of the average salaries of graduates of Russian universities in the period 2017–2022. The study covers traditional state universities and those specialising in economics. Data was collected from the SuperJob CV database (which contains over 30 million CVs) and other open sources for the period up until two months before the ranking’s publication. The ranking lists the top twenty Russian universities by graduate pay.
